The ACT National is designed to assess high school students' general educational development and their ability to complete college level work. The ACT National is a three hour test that covers three skill areas: English (45 minutes), Mathematics (60 minutes), Reading (35 minutes). Science (35 minutes) and Writing (40 minutes) can be selected as additional areas during registration.

Cost:

For the regular registration deadline:

  • $70 (English, Math, Reading)
  • $75 (English, Math, Reading, Science)
  • $95 (English, Math, Reading, Writing)
  • $100 (English, Math, Reading, Science, Writing)
